Firefighters Endorse Rep. Lesser

 

Peter S. Carozza, Jr., President of the Uniformed Professional Fire Fighters Association of Connecticut, announced today his association’s endorsement of MATT LESSER in the upcoming elections.

In making the endorsement, President Carozza stated, “It is an honor to announce that following the recommendation of the Executive Board and the Political Action Committee, the Uniformed Professional Fire Fighters Association of Connecticut heartily endorses REPRESENTATIVE MATT LESSER, D-100, for re-election this November.

This action was taken after careful consideration of his record of support for the Professional Fire Fighters of Connecticut and his leadership in helping to insure the health and safety of our members and that of our fellow citizens.”

President James Mastroianni of the South Fire District Professional Fire Fighters Local 3918 also added his voice of support to Representative Lesser’s re-election bid. “Matt Lesser has been a friend of South Fire Distict's Professional Fire Fighters for many years and we fully support this endorsement”, said Mastroianni

In commenting on the endorsement, Paul Rapanault, the Director of Legislative and Political Affairs for the UPFFA said, “We believe that professionalism and leadership in the field of Public Safety is indispensable to the citizens of the State of Connecticut in the continuing debate on Homeland Security. We need strong voices in that debate. Matt Lesser has a proven record of being one of those voices.”

The Uniformed Professional Fire Fighters Association of Connecticut is the state association of the International Association of Fire Fighters, which represents 60 affiliated local unions in the state, comprising about 4200 members.
